Himachal Pradesh on yellow alert for heavy rain

SHIMLA: Himachal Pradesh is on yellow alert for two days in anticipation of heavy rainfall at isolated places along with thunderstorm, lightning, and gust (wind speed 30 to 40 kilometres an hour) in Chamba, Kangra, Hamirpur, Kullu, Mandi, Shimla, and Sirmaur districts.

Rain and snowfall in the higher reaches has caused the minimum and maximum temperatures at several stations in the state to fall sharply in the last 24 hours. On Sunday, the least temperature of 4.5 degrees Celsius was recorded at Keylong in Lahaul-Spiti district, while the highest of 33.2°C was at Una.

The weather office also warned of disruptions of essential services such as water, electricity, and communications, while the visibility is also likely to drop. There is al possibility of landslides as well due to heavy rainfall in the hilly regions.
